I'm a high student that hasn't been flying for at least 4 years. The Tiger 400 ARF was never completed. I don't have the time to finish, due to the portfolio im preparing for college. So I planning to buy a GWS slowstick. I already have a JR XF631 72MH controller, What servo, reciever, battery should i use?

for the motor,
select any lipo battery from the same site, around 1000-2200mah, a 2200 mah will last you well over half a hour....but it wont fit in the gws tiger moth (is that the one your talking about?^^) as well as a 1500, unless you cut out the battery area...i use a 2200 in my gws slowstick. works great
servos, the hxt900 will work great from the same site...and you cant beat the price at 3.50 or so each
reciever they have gws recievers that might be a good buy, i have never used one, but heard good things about them
Hobbycity.com will be the best and cheapest place to buy what u want
shipping is expensive, but the crazy low prices will easily make up for it
btw if you order from HC, unless you use ems shipping it will take about 3 weeks for your stuff to come
